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Восстановлени mdf файла / 2 сообщений из 2, страница 1 из 1
07.05.2002, 11:20
    #32029643
magnus
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Восстановлени mdf файла
Свалилась на голову большая беда. Вырос до необычайных размеров файл транзакций ldf и на диске кончилось место. База заблокировалась. Удалили файл транзакций и теперь при подключении mdf файла ругается на отсутствие ldf и остается в заблокированном виде. Создание новой базы и подмена испорченной не помогает. Как можно восстановить или хотябы забрать информацию из этого файла? Есть ли какие нибуть утилиты по восстановлению и просмотру этих файлов?
...
Рейтинг: 0 / 0
07.05.2002, 12:41
    #32029653
Дед Маздай
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Восстановлени mdf файла
Не Вы первый Попрощайтесь с тем, что незакоммитили, но базу поднять удастся. В любом случае это лучше, чем потерять все. Действуйте по инструкции Q232518:

1. Сделайте backup того, что осталось.
2. Use Master
Go
sp_configure 'allow', 1
reconfigure with override
Go
3. Записали на бумажке результат select status from sysdatabases where name = '<db_name>' на случай неудачи ребилда лога.
Затем update sysdatabases set status = 32768 where name = '<db_name>'
4. Перезапустили SQL Server.
5. DBCC REBUILD_LOG('<db_name>','<имя нового лога с указанием полного пути>'). SQL Server скажет Warning: The log for database '<db_name>' has been rebuilt. Если скажет что-нибудь другое, дайте знать.
6. sp_dboption '<db_name>', 'single user', 'true'
7. DBCC CHECKDB('<db_name>', REPAIR_ALLOW_DATA_LOSS)
И кады чвакнет, бегишь за бутылкой, потому как пронесло
Не забудьте вернуть взад dboption и allow updates.
...
Рейтинг: 0 / 0
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Восстановлени mdf файла / 2 сообщений из 2,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]